: well, if you want each body part to be a seperate md2, then it would need to be seperate objects. but if you plan on making this guy as 1 md2, then it must be one object.

No, thats not quite true, you can make a model out of as many
objects as you want, the quake2 guy for example is made out of
around 7 objects (or smth) , I talk about objects, not files.
You don´t need make morphing animations... you can also
make simple pivot animations. The quake2 guy is made out
of a mixture.
Though morphing animations look more real on biological objects
because multi object animations always look kinda mechanical.
Paul Steed made a pretty good mixture of both.


Whatsoever, the md2 can be as well as mdl´s made out
of multiple objects.
